    Measuring devices of the GHP 900 series, which are especially designed for thicker specimens with a high gross DensityThe mass density is defined as the ratio between mass and volume. density, are suitable for a wide range of applications. The design of the device permits samples to be inserted into the test chamber from any side. This allows for the insertion of heavy and complex samples without damaging the measuring plates. Data acquisition and control of the device are handled by the external Lambda Control desktop device alongside a PC with Windows operating system and Lambda software.

    Guarded Hot Plate – Principle of Operation 

    The hot plate and the guard ring are sandwiched between two samples of the same material and approximately the same thickness, d. Cold plates are placed above and below the samples. All plate temperatures are controlled such that a well‐ defined, user‐selectable temperature difference, ΔT, is established between the hot and the cold plates – and thus across the sample thickness. The guard ring is maintained exactly at hot plate temperature in order to minimize lateral heat losses.

    Specifications

    All features at a glance

      GHP 900
    Measuring range 0.005 to 2.0 W/(m·K), depending on material and thickness
    Specimen size (L x W)

    900 mm x 900 mm 

    variable, according to the dimension of the hot plate: 200 mm x 200 mm up to 500 mm x 500 mm

    Specimen thickness (H) 
    • 1x 15 mm to 280 mm (1-specimen measurement method)
    • 2x 15 mm to 140 mm (2-specimen measurement method)
    Temperature range
    • Cooling plate: -10°C to 60°C
    • Heating plate: -0°C to 70°C
    Interface 1x RS 232,1x Gigabit Ethernet
    Dimensions (H x W x D) 233 cm x 146 cm x 126 cm (opened hood)
    Power supply 110 V to 230 V, 50/60 Hz
    Weight 278 kg
